Back from the holidays
Ok, the last part of my summer holidays is now over, and its back to work for me. This week has been full of meetings, most notably our UI-design people!
Currently we don't have the UI-design yet, but we will have a draft ready in about a week! Right now, the project has been split into two teams/projects: the so-called "core" team, and the "gui" team, of which the graphical designers are a part.
The CORE team is (obviously) very much involved in implementing the below architecture, with its low-level services and other doodads...
The GUI team, on the other hand, is brainstorming the design and figuring out how to actually draw the Qt-widgets etc. using HW acceleration and different effects.
All kinds of demos, protos and other neat graphical stuff abounds, I'll try to post something concrete later on - stay tuned :-)
